Coast sickle cell 'warrior' rescues kids suffering from the disease

Gladicy Mbeyu a Sickle Cell Disease patient and a teacher at Kilimo primary school in Kilifi during an interview with the standard at Kilifi South constituency in Kilifi county. Gladicy was awarded a state commendation for helping children battling diseases in the coastal region,by president William Ruto last year. [Marion Kithi,Standard]

It is one hour at a time for Gladicy Mbeyu, a sickle cell warrior who was last year awarded a state commendation for helping children battling diseases in the coastal region.

Ms Mbeyu, 56, says although the disease was in her body from birth, the severity and symptoms of sickle cell disease vary over time. And they are painful episodes and complications.
